Code of Conduct - Candidates

SDA's Duty to the Candidate
On initial contact with a candidate, SDA will provide clear and accurate information about the services we provide.

SDA will agree with candidates the procedure for submitting their details to clients. SDA will not disclose a candidate's identity and/or identifiable employment details to a client without first obtaining the candidate's permission unless the candidate has agreed in advance that we may do otherwise.

SDA will treat information about candidates confidentially except for the purpose of filling a vacancy and will encourage clients to do likewise.

SDA will make every effort to provide candidates with detailed job and person specifications.

Where possible, SDA will keep candidates informed of the progress of their application.

SDA will endeavour to give clear and honest feedback to candidates following interviews.

SDA will state clearly to candidates at what stage we will take up references and how they will be used.

SDA will not approach a current employer without the candidate's permission. Information obtained through a reference must be treated as confidential to the recruitment process.

SDA is committed to equal opportunities and positively welcomes candidates from all sections of the community.
